At first glance, coffee polyester fiber sounds like a cup of morning joe transformed into fabric. The reality is less straightforward but no less interesting. The concept repurposes spent coffee grounds into fibers, combining them with recycled polyester. This blend is touted as eco-friendly, offering natural odor control and UV protection — not claims you'd expect from your regular brew.

Adapting coffee polyester fiber to mass production isn’t without hurdles. A significant issue is the consistency of raw material input. Coffee grounds vary greatly depending on the source, affecting the uniformity of the final product. This variability presents a significant production challenge for manufacturers aiming for scale.
Industry skepticism is another challenge. While the environmental benefits are clear—the reuse of waste, reduction in petroleum dependence—skeptics argue about the energy costs in processing and shipping grounds across the globe. The eco-benefit balance is a debate that continues to evolve.
Real-world applications are increasing, yet trust comes slowly in traditional manufacturing sectors. Overcoming hesitation takes time—and continuous proof that the benefits outweigh the uncertainties.
